The Dungannon Bowl Pimlico Loser Weeper Vanderbilt 1950 Sterling Silver

.The Dungannon Bowl  Pimlico Loser Weeper Vanderbilt 1950 Sterling Silver

code: wb3646

American sterling silver trophy bowl by Schofield and company Silversmiths of Baltimore Maryland, c.1950. We have only good silver, some better, but this is among our best.
A large, circular footed bowl inscribed:
A TRUE COPY OF

The Dungannon Bowl

Perpetual Trophy for the Dixie Handicap
Offered by the
Maryland Jockey Club
Pimlico Race Course
(on one side)
Three-Year Olds and Upward
One Mile and Three Sixteenths

$20,000 Added

Saturday, May 13-1950
WON BY

Looser Weeper

OWNED BY

Alfred G. Vanderbilt

(on the other)
This special trophy bowl is 8 1/2" in diameter, 5" tall and weighs 928 grams or 29.8 ozs. Troy. Inscribed as described above, the soft, warm, original finish is present, with no buffing or machine polishing. The excellent original condition and clear detail, with no removals, repairs or alterations, make this an especially attractive offering. CLICK HERE for info on The Dixie Stakes CLICK HERE for info on Alfred G. Vanderbilt Loser Weeper holds the record time for one mile and three sixteenths @1:56.20 His trainer, Max Hirsch, is a member of the Racing hall of Fame. His Jockey, Nick Combest, had the ride of his life that day, later enjoying much success as a trainer.

Compotes Ornate Floral Scroll Chantilly Gorham Pair 1895 No Monogram

.Compotes Ornate Floral Scroll Chantilly Gorham Pair 1895 No Monogram

code: wb3401

American sterling silver compotes by Gorham Silversmiths in a pattern that very much resembles Chantilly, c.1895 and retailed by Spaulding and Company of Chicago. Spaulding originated in Chicago in 1855 and was purchased by Gorham in 1920. These compotes likely pre-date 1920. Each of of these ornate compotes has a Repousse scroll, floral and foliate border on the rim of the plate and base. Weighing a total of 764 grams or 24.6 ozs. Troy, each compote is 8" in diameter (plate), 4 5/8" diameter (base and4" tall. The soft, warm, original finish is present, with no buffing or machine polishing. The excellent original condition and clear, crisp detail, with no monograms, removals, repairs or alterations, make this an especially attractive offering.

Sterling Silver Chrysanthemum Compote Dominick and Haff 1896

.Sterling Silver Chrysanthemum Compote Dominick and Haff 1896

code: wb3051

American sterling silver company Dominick and Haff of New York was founded after the Civil War in 1868 and made very high end sterling holloware and flatware until they became part of Reed & Barton in 1928. This chrysanthemem compote crafted in c.1896 is a stunning and magnificent example of their impressive work. It features an exquisite applied chrysanthemum border on the the upper bowl as well as the unweighted pedestal base. It stands 4 5/8" in height, 10" in diameter and weighs 817 grams or 26.3 ozs Troy. Aesthetic Period Sterling Silver Gorham Basket Providence 1882

.Aesthetic Period Sterling Silver Gorham Basket Providence 1882

code: wb3131

Charming Aesthetic period sterling silver sugar basket with decoratively engraved cherry blossoms. Made by Gorham of Providence, Rhode Island c.1882, this little sugar bowl with it′s delicate swinging handle, is a superb example of the style Europe was enchanted by and described as Japonaiserie. After an American and Japanese trade treaty was signed in 1858, Japanese motifs began to significantly influence western art and designs of the American and European Aesthetic period. It has a 4 1/8" diameter, measures 2 1/8" in deep, stands 5" tall with the handle extended and weighs a substantial 124 grams or 4 ozs Troy.
